A day in the life.
As a Commercial Lines Client Executive within the Business Insurance team, you'll utilize your exceptional client servicing skills to maintain and expand client relationships within your own assigned book of accounts and also provide professional insurance services to our clients by coordinating with Producers, Underwriters, Service Team members and other departments too. This includes, but not limited to, providing coverage analysis and risk management recommendations, completing applications, preparing submissions, negotiating coverage and pricing with carriers and preparing proposals according to agency standards. You may also be called on to resolve issues related to billing, make policy changes, respond to policy coverage related questions in a timely and professional manner, and prepare exposure comparison, premium comparisons, renewal reviews and renewal proposals.
All Client Executives are expected to participate in continuing education to maintain a P&C license, stay current with all regulations and enhance insurance knowledge.
Our future colleague.
We'd love to meet you if your professional track record includes the following:
- Active Property & Casualty license
- 10+ years relevant commercial lines insurance experience, with at least 3 years in a brokerage environment
- Experience in managing assigned accounts through the client life cycle, including the renewal process.
- Demonstrated ability to expand services at each renewal through upselling and cross selling.
- Effective oral and written communication and relationship building skills a must; demonstrated ability to converse with all levels of internal colleagues and external clients and vendors
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, managing escalated client issues
- Significant experience facilitating client meetings and presentations
- High level of proficiency with Microsoft Office products, including Word, Excel and PowerPoint as well as agency management systems and web browser software
These additional qualifications are a plus, but not required to apply:
- Bachelor's Degree in Risk Management, Business Administration or other related fields
- Insurance designations

The applicable base salary range for this role is $90,100 to $167,900.
The base pay offered will be determined on factors such as experience, skills, training, location, certifications, education, and any applicable minimum wage requirements. Decisions will be determined on a case-by-case basis. In addition to the base salary, this position may be eligible for performance-based incentives.
